Output 053325330970b4b976708075c716e129f371ffee39faffb8e603db5f63cb01fc:5

value
295000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490fcc65bf9e680f61d8a99a6d63524e0d749a05 OP_EQUAL
address
38MLBExCtT9BsTrtzTKaiRDMNf791z6jeX
transaction
053325330970b4b976708075c716e129f371ffee39faffb8e603db5f63cb01fc
confirmations
320011
spent
true